Who drafted Tyson Chandler?

the Los Angeles Clippers
Chandler was selected by the Los Angeles Clippers with the second overall pick in the 2001 NBA draft, before being immediately traded to the Chicago Bulls for former No. 1 overall pick Elton Brand. The Bulls placed their rebuilding efforts on the backs of two teenagers in Chandler and Eddy Curry.

Which NBA draft class has the most Hall of Famers?

It was held at the Felt Forum at Madison Square Garden in New York City, New York, on June 19, 1984, before the 1984–85 season. The draft is generally considered to be one of the greatest in NBA history, with four Hall of Famers being drafted in the first sixteen picks and five overall.

Which pick was LeBron James in draft?

2003 NBA Draft As two highly-touted prospects, LeBron was selected No. 1 overall by the Cleveland Cavaliers in the 2003 NBA Draft while Melo went No. 3 to the Denver Nuggets.

What is considered the best NBA draft of all time?

We can argue about the order, but it’s almost indisputable that the four best draft classes in NBA history were 1984, 1985, 1996 and 2003. Each of those drafts produced at least one all-time great and had a lot of depth. From 1985, the legendary player was the 13th pick, Karl Malone.
